Как поменять цвет листа в Excel: 5 способов с пояснениями

Цвет вкладок в Microsoft Excel — это не просто эстетический элемент, а мощный инструмент визуальной организации данных. Когда вы работаете с десятками листов в одной книге, правильно подобранная цветовая схема помогает мгновенно ориентироваться между отчетами, справочниками и расчетными таблицами. Но как именно изменить цвет вкладки, если стандартный серый фон сливается в единую массу? Эта статья раскроет все нюансы — от элементарного изменения цвета до автоматического окрашивания через макросы.

Мы рассмотрим не только базовые действия через контекстное меню, но и малоизвестные приемы: как применить цвет ко всем листам одновременно, почему иногда опция недоступна, и как обойти ограничения в онлайн-версии Excel. Особое внимание уделим типичным ошибкам — например, когда выбранный цвет не сохраняется после перезапуска программы. Готовы превратить хаотичный набор вкладок в удобную цветовую систему? Начнем с самого простого.

Базовый способ: изменение цвета через контекстное меню

Самый быстрый метод, который работает во всех версиях Excel начиная с 2007 года. Вам не потребуется запоминать горячие клавиши или искать скрытые настройки — всё делается в два клика. Вот пошаговая инструкция:

1. Кликните правой кнопкой мыши по названию листа (вкладке) в нижней части окна.

2. В появившемся меню выберите пункт Цвет ярлычка (в английской версии — Tab Color).

3. Откроется палитра с 10 стандартными цветами и опцией Другие цвета... для расширенного выбора.

4. Выберите нужный оттенок — цвет вкладки изменится мгновенно.

  • 🎨 Ограничение палитры: Стандартные 10 цветов нельзя редактировать, но можно добавить свои через Другие цвета
  • 🔍 Прозрачность: В Excel 2019+ появилась возможность задавать полупрозрачные оттенки
  • 📌 Быстрый доступ: Двойной клик по вкладке тоже открывает меню с опцией цвета

Важно: если пункт Цвет ярлычка неактивен (серого цвета), это означает, что книга защищена от изменений или у вас недостаточно прав доступа. В корпоративных версиях Excel администраторы иногда ограничивают такие функции через групповую политику.

📊 Как часто вы используете цветные вкладки в Excel?
Никогда не пробовал
Редко, для важных листов
Постоянно, для всех проектов
Предпочитаю стандартный вид

Расширенная палитра: как создать уникальный оттенок

Стандартные 10 цветов быстро приедаются, особенно когда нужно выделить десятки листов. К счастью, Excel позволяет создавать до 16 миллионов уникальных оттенков через диалоговое окно Другие цвета. Вот как это работает:

1. Кликните правой кнопкой по вкладке → Цвет ярлычкаДругие цвета...

2. В открывшемся окне выберите вкладку Спектр для ручного подбора или Стандартные для готовых палитр

3. Для точной настройки используйте:

- Ползунки Оттенок/Насыщенность/Яркость (HSL)

- Поля ввода Красный/Зеленый/Синий (RGB)

- Шестнадцатеричный код цвета (HEX)

4. Нажмите OK, чтобы применить

Параметр Диапазон значений Пример использования
RGB 0-255 для каждого канала RGB(255, 192, 203) — пастельный розовый
HEX #000000 — #FFFFFF #4682B4 — корпоративный синий
HSL Оттенок: 0-359°, Насыщенность/Яркость: 0-100% H:120°, S:100%, L:50% — чистый зеленый

Профессиональный совет: если вам нужно поддерживать фирменный стиль компании, сохраните HEX-коды бренда в отдельном файле. Так вы сможете быстро применять их ко всем документам. Например, цвет логотипа Microsoft — это #F25022 (оранжевый), а Google использует #4285F4 (синий).

⚠️ Внимание: В Excel Online расширенная палитра недоступна — там можно выбрать только из 10 стандартных цветов. Для полноценной работы с оттенками используйте десктопную версию.

Массовое изменение цвета: как окрасить несколько листов сразу

Когда в книге 50+ листов, красить каждый вручную — мучение. К сожалению, в Excel нет встроенной функции массового окрашивания, но есть три обходных пути:

Способ 1. Группировка листов (работает для одинакового цвета):

  1. Зажмите Ctrl и кликните по всем нужным вкладкам (они выделятся белым)
  2. Кликните правой кнопкой по любой выделенной вкладке → Цвет ярлычка
  3. Выберите цвет — он применится ко всем выделенным листам

Способ 2. Макрос VBA (для разных цветов):

Sub ColorTabs()

Dim ws As Worksheet

Dim colors As Variant

colors = Array(1, 3, 5, 7, 9) ' Индексы цветов из стандартной палитры

i = 0

For Each ws In ThisWorkbook.Worksheets

ws.Tab.ColorIndex = colors(i Mod UBound(colors) + 1)

i = i + 1

Next ws

End Sub

Способ 3. Power Query (продвинутый):

Создайте таблицу с названиями листов и желаемыми цветами в формате HEX, затем используйте Power Query для автоматического применения. Этот метод требует знания M-кода, но позволяет гибко управлять большими книгами.

Создайте резервную копию книги|Проверьте названия листов на опечатки|Выберите цветовую схему заранее|Протестируйте на 2-3 листах перед массовым изменением-->

Почему цвет вкладки не сохраняется: типичные проблемы и решения

Одна из самых распространенных жалоб пользователей: "Я поменял цвет, сохранил файл, а при следующем открытии всё сбросилось!" Причины могут быть разными — от багов программы до конфликтов с надстройками. Разберем основные сценарии:

  • 💾 Автосохранение в OneDrive: Если файл хранится в облаке, иногда происходит откат к предыдущей версии. Отключите автосохранение на время изменения цветов.
  • 🔄 Конфликт версий: При совместной работе несколько пользователей могут перезаписывать изменения. Используйте функцию Общий доступ с блокировкой ячеек.
  • 🛠️ Поврежденный файл: Если цвет сбрасывается только в одном файле, попробуйте создать новый и перенести данные через Переместить/Скопировать.
  • 🖥️ Ограничения версий: В Excel 2003 и старше цвет вкладок не поддерживается вообще. Обновите программу.

Особый случай — Excel для Mac. В версиях до 2019 года там была ошибка, из-за которой цвета вкладок отображались правильно, но не сохранялись в файле. Исправлено в обновлении 16.27. Решение: обновите программу через App Store или используйте веб-версию.

⚠️ Внимание: Если вы используете Защиту книги (пароль на структуру), изменение цветов вкладок будет заблокировано до снятия защиты. Перейдите в Рецензирование → Снять защиту книги.

Продвинутые трюки: динамическое окрашивание и автоматизация

Для опытных пользователей, которые хотят вывести организацию листов на новый уровень, есть несколько продвинутых техник:

1. Условное окрашивание по имени листа:

С помощью VBA можно настроить автоматическое изменение цвета в зависимости от названия вкладки. Например, все листы с словом "Отчет" красятся в зеленый, а с "Черновик" — в красный:

Sub AutoColorTabs()

Dim ws As Worksheet

For Each ws In ThisWorkbook.Worksheets

If InStr(1, ws.Name, "Отчет") > 0 Then

ws.Tab.Color = RGB(144, 238, 144) ' LightGreen

ElseIf InStr(1, ws.Name, "Черновик") > 0 Then

ws.Tab.Color = RGB(255, 182, 193) ' LightPink

End If

Next ws

End Sub

2. Синхронизация с данными:

Можно привязать цвет вкладки к значению конкретной ячейки. Например, если в A1 стоит "Готово", лист становится зеленым:

Sub ColorByCell()

Dim ws As Worksheet

For Each ws In ThisWorkbook.Worksheets

If ws.Range("A1").Value = "Готово" Then

ws.Tab.Color = RGB(0, 255, 0)

ElseIf ws.Range("A1").Value = "В работе" Then

ws.Tab.Color = RGB(255, 255, 0)

End If

Next ws

End Sub

3. Градиентное окрашивание:

Для визуального разделения больших книг можно использовать плавный переход цветов. Это требует написания более сложного макроса с расчетом оттенков, но результат стоит усилий — книга становится похожа на профессионально оформленный дашборд.

Как сделать градиент для 50 листов?

Используйте цикл с шагом изменения RGB-значений. Например, начинайте с RGB(255,0,0) и постепенно уменьшайте красный канал, увеличивая зеленый: For i = 1 To 50: ws.Tab.Color = RGB(255 - (i*5), 0 + (i*5), 0): Next i. Это создаст плавный переход от красного к зеленому.

Цветовые схемы для разных задач: рекомендации по оформлению

Выбор цветов — это не только вопрос вкуса, но и функциональности. Психологически разные оттенки воспринимаются по-разному, а в деловой среде некоторые комбинации могут вызывать непреднамеренные ассоциации. Вот проверенные схемы для типичных сценариев:

Тип листа Рекомендуемый цвет HEX-код Почему этот цвет
Главный отчет Темно-синий #003366 Выглядит профессионально, ассоциируется с надежностью
Черновики Серый #999999 Нейтральный, не отвлекает внимание
Срочные задачи Красный #FF0000 Мгновенно привлекает внимание
Архивные данные Фиолетовый #9933FF Редко используется в бизнесе, хорошо выделяется
Справочники Зеленый #00CC66 Ассоциируется с информацией и ростом

Для людей с дальтонизмом избегайте сочетаний красный/зеленый и синий/фиолетовый. Используйте контрастные цвета вроде черного/желтого или белого/оранжевого. В Excel 2016+ есть встроенная проверка доступности: перейдите в Файл → Сведения → Проверка на наличие проблем → Проверка доступности.

Интересный факт: в Google Sheets цвет вкладок синхронизируется с цветом текста в ячейке A1, если она не пустая. В Excel такой функции нет, но её можно эмулировать через VBA.

Альтернативные методы визуальной организации

Цвет — не единственный способ структурировать листы. В некоторых случаях более эффективны другие приемы:

  • 📑 Группировка листов: Выделите несколько вкладок, кликните правой кнопкой → Группировать. Они будут объединены в папку.
  • 🔤 Префиксы в названиях: Используйте аббревиатуры вроде "[OTЧ] Отчет за март" или "[СПР] Справочник клиентов".
  • 📍 Перемещение вкладок: Самые важные листы перетащите влево — они открываются первыми.
  • 🔗 Гиперссылки: Создайте оглавление на отдельном листе с ссылками на все разделы книги.
  • 📊 Миниатюры: В Excel 2019+ при наведении на вкладку показывается preview содержимого.

Комбинация цветов и этих методов дает наилучший результат. Например, можно:

  1. Сгруппировать все отчеты за квартал в одну папку
  2. Окрасить их в оттенки зеленого (от темного к светлому по месяцам)
  3. Добавить префикс "[Q1]" в названия

Такой подход позволяет находить нужный лист за 2-3 секунды даже в книге с 100+ вкладками.

FAQ: Ответы на частые вопросы

Можно ли сделать градиентный цвет для одной вкладки?

Нет, в Excel каждая вкладка может быть только однотонной. Однако вы можете эмулировать градиент, создав несколько вкладок с плавным переходом цветов и назвав их одинаково (например, "Отчет_1", "Отчет_2" и т.д.).

Почему при печати цвет вкладок не отображается?

Цвет вкладок — это элемент интерфейса программы, он не является частью печатной области. Если вам нужно визуально разделить данные при печати, используйте Разрывы страниц или фоновые цвета для ячеек.

Как вернуть стандартный серый цвет?

Кликните правой кнопкой по вкладке → Цвет ярлычка → выберите Нет цвета (в английской версии — No Color). Это сбросит окраску к стандартной.

Можно ли изменить цвет вкладки через горячие клавиши?

Стандартных горячих клавиш для этого действия нет, но вы можете создать собственное сочетание через Настройка ленты → Сочетания клавиш. Или используйте этот макрос с назначением на клавишу:

Sub QuickTabColor()

ActiveSheet.Tab.Color = RGB(255, 255, 0) ' Желтый цвет

End Sub

Почему в Excel Online нет опции "Другие цвета"?

Это ограничение веб-версии. Microsoft сознательно сократил функционал Excel Online для ускорения работы в браузере. Для полноценной работы с цветами используйте десктопную версию или мобильное приложение (там расширенная палитра доступна).